    Each Wednesday we will offer a good sized diamond for a ridiculous price.  The idea came from our customers who are looking to sell their diamonds for more than the cash price offered by dealers.  If we can sell their diamonds quickly and for more than they can get elsewhere and not be paying, from out of our pocket, why not? 
    Only one loose diamond will be sold each week.  First come first served.  It must be paid in full including tax at the time of sale.  It will not be held for any amount of time.  You may remember a year or so I did this for a customer and sold it to the first customer that came into the store, the first day it was offered.

    When the economy went bad about four years ago,  I was just moving into my new store here in The Olde Ridge Shopping Village (great timing).  I got a call from a lady named Allison who asked me who my refiner was and I told her I thought she must have the wrong number.  Around here when you think of refiners you think of Marcus Hook.  Well as it turned out after she told me about buying gold and why I needed a good and trusted refiner she actually saved my business, for about that time sales were taking a very big nose dive.  Buying  gold jewelry from customers who were trying to keep their heads above water was about the only business there was outside of repairs.

    Then came the "I buy gold" guys on every corner and every other commercial on TV.  Many of them  were less than reputable.  A recent article in a trade magazine said by far, the customer will find the best value selling their gold jewelry by going to their family jeweler.

    We tested the market.  I paid a customer $200.00 for a gold chain then asked my daughter to go try to sell it.  I won't say where she went but the first guy offered her $60.00.  She said she was spooked by the guy and the place.  She said no to the offer and the guy told her its just gold to me.

    The thing that I wonder about is when the gold slows to a stop and the "I Buy Gold" guys move on to their next racket who is going to put a battery in your watch, repair a broken bracelet or even SELL you something like a diamond engagement ring, who are you going to go to?

    At the same time sales went down, gold went up, and about the only window of opportunity left for your family jeweler to stay in business was to start buying back the jewelry that he had been selling for so long to you, your Mom and Dad and Grandparents.  In the case of my family, jewelers for the last 109 years.  As a result of this trend we have an excellent selection of estate gold jewelry with some magnificent pieces.  All of our silver jewelry is new and mostly rhodium plated so it won't tarnish for years.  And lastly we sell that department store jewelry to Allison.
